百科知识
安卓APP开发框架
什么是安卓APP开发框架?
安卓APP开发框架是为了开发安卓应用程序的程序框架,使用它可以简化开发过程,提高开发效率。在安卓APP开发框架中提供了各种工具和库,使开发人员可以更快地创建高质量的安卓应用程序。
安卓APP开发框架包括哪些内容?
安卓APP开发框架包括以下几个方面:
Android SDK:Android软件开发工具包,提供了创建安卓应用程序的所有工具和API。
Java编程语言:由于安卓应用程序是用Java编写的,因此Java编程语言是框架中的重要组成部分。
IDE:Integrated Development Environment,集成开发环境,使开发人员可以快速开发应用程序。
第三方库:提供了各种可重用的代码和功能,使开发人员可以更快速地开发应用程序。
为什么使用安卓APP开发框架?
使用安卓APP开发框架的好处如下:
提高开发效率:使用安卓APP开发框架可以降低开发成本,缩短开发时间。
提供优化过的编程环境:在IDE中,开发人员可以更好地组织代码,提高代码质量和可读性。
提供可重用的代码:框架中的第三方库提供了各种可重用的代码和功能,使开发人员可以更快速地开发应用程序。
使应用程序更稳定:使用框架中提供的工具和库可以使应用程序更稳定,减少崩溃和错误。
哪些安卓APP开发框架比较流行?
以下是目前比较流行的安卓APP开发框架:
Android Studio:谷歌推出的IDE,支持Kotlin和Java。
Xamarin:Microsoft开发的应用程序开发框架,支持C#。
React Native:由Facebook开发的跨平台框架,支持JavaScript。
Flutter:谷歌推出的跨平台框架,支持Dart。
PhoneGap:Apache开源的跨平台框架,可使用HTML、CSS和JavaScript编写应用程序。
如何选择合适的安卓APP开发框架?
选择合适的安卓APP开发框架可以提高开发效率,但需要根据项目需求来确定。以下是一些选择框架时应考虑的因素:
开发人员技能水平:框架使用的编程语言和工具是否与开发人员的技能相匹配?
项目需求:项目需要什么功能?哪种框架最适合实现这些功能?
可靠性和稳定性:框架是否已经得到广泛应用?是否经过了充分测试?
社区支持:框架支持社区是否活跃,是否存在可靠的文档和教程?
结论
安卓APP开发框架使开发人员可以更快速地创建高质量的安卓应用程序。要选择最适合项目需求的框架,需要考虑开发人员的技能水平、项目需求、框架的可靠性和稳定性以及社区支持。目前流行的框架有Android Studio、Xamarin、React Native、Flutter和PhoneGap等。
下一篇:缴纳社保会计分录